Article Abstract:
Effect of globalization and tourism on Guatemala and initiatives taken by international social work to address educational needs of natives to support the transition into modern world is examined. The foundations of social work education and locally-specific self-determination are very important in the practice of international social work.

Article Abstract:
The problems and issues of applying western research methodology in Malaysia, towards development of a culturally appropriate social work practice are discussed. The study reveals that, theoretical development of culturally appropriate social work needs to be conducted within an indigenous research paradigm.

Article Abstract:
Issues regarding the social rights of the mentally ill in Malaysia are discussed. A framework in which the country can better meet its contractual obligations to its mentally ill citizens is given, and the argument is supported with research on mental health in Sarawak.
